    When someone includes “NPNC” in their profile, they are essentially saying they will ignore or block any attempts to start a conversation unless a profile picture is visible.

    This acronym isn’t part of any official guideline—rather, it has emerged organically within the community as a shorthand for setting expectations. Also see: Raw Only.

    TL;DR

    NPNC is short for No Pic, No Chat, a phrase often found in LGBTQ+ dating app profiles like Grindr.
